Kirk Cousins wondered early in the Washington Redskins' game against the Green Bay Packers if the wind would make it difficult. Instead, Cousins gripped the ball tighter, ripped it into the air and threw for 375 yards and three touchdowns to lead the Redskins to a 42-24 victory Sunday night, Washington's sixth victory in eight games.
